Dhaka, Nov 23 (bdnews24.com) –Abdul Mannan, an advisor to the main opposition BNP chairperson Khaleda Zia, has been made BNP president of its Dhaka district unit.
Mannan is also a former state minister for civil aviation and tourism.
Confirming the appointment, the party's office secretary Ruhul Kabir Rizvi told bdnews24.com on Tuesday, "The secretary general has made the appointment according to the approval of the chairperson."
Mannan replaces barrister Nazmul Huda, who was also a BNP vice-chairman and was recently expelled from the BNP for speaking against the party.
The national standing committee of the BNP, at a meeting chaired by its chairperson Khaleda in the party's Gulshan office, took the decision on Sunday.
